Factors Affecting Cost

House raising in Farmington, MI, is a project often undertaken to protect homes from flood risks, facilitate foundation repairs, or prepare for renovations.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help homeowners plan effectively for this process.

  • Materials used: Primarily steel beams, concrete blocks, and temporary supports to safely lift and stabilize the structure.
  • Size and scope: Varies based on house dimensions, foundation type, and desired height increase, often involving multiple floors or full elevation.
  • Labor complexity: Involves specialized equipment and skilled labor to ensure stability and safety during the lift and subsequent work.
  • Permitting requirements: Typically requires permits from local authorities to ensure compliance with building codes and regulations.
  • Additional considerations: May include foundation repairs, utility disconnections/reconnections, and site cleanup as part of the project scope.
